Output f24f0cd5e86d79aa56ccb587457ca7f0d875662b86910b2c272cd2da27fab6d8:23

value
309320862
script pubkey
OP_0 OP_PUSHBYTES_20 e8dd3acf606c54aa57316f6a2bd1ebabf9485b5d
address
bc1qarwn4nmqd32254e3da4zh50t40u5sk6ah7knp3
transaction
f24f0cd5e86d79aa56ccb587457ca7f0d875662b86910b2c272cd2da27fab6d8
confirmations
188786
spent
true